Ukrainian passport holders can get a visa on arrival in Samoa. You'll handle it at the airport in Apia — no need to apply before you travel. This has been the case since at least 2024.

Valid passport
Must be valid for the duration of your stay
Your passport must be valid for at least 6 months from your date of entry into Samoa. Airlines check this before boarding — if your passport expires sooner, you will be denied boarding.Required
Return or onward ticket
Proof of departure from Samoa
Immigration at Faleolo Airport will ask for a confirmed onward or return ticket before granting entry. Budget airlines flying into Samoa enforce this strictly — have your booking confirmation ready.Required
Proof of accommodation
Hotel booking or host invitation
Have a printed or digital hotel reservation for your first few nights. If staying with friends or family, a letter of invitation with their contact details works.Recommended

What happens at the border

1
Arrive at Faleolo International Airport (APW)
After landing, follow signs to Immigration. There's a dedicated queue for visa-on-arrival applicants. Have your passport, return ticket, and accommodation confirmation ready.
2
Present documents and pay the fee
Hand over your passport and supporting documents. The officer will process your visa on the spot. Payment is in Samoan tālā (WST) — cash only. No card accepted.
3
Receive your visa and enter Samoa
Once approved, the officer stamps your passport with the visa. You're free to go. The whole process usually takes 10–20 minutes.

Transiting through Samoa

No transit visa needed

Ukrainian passport holders transiting through Samoa's Faleolo International Airport (APW) do not need a transit visa if they remain airside and have a confirmed onward ticket within 24 hours.

Health risks
Dengue feverModerate risk

Mosquito-borne; outbreaks occur, especially during rainy season (November–April). Use repellent and mosquito nets.

Zika virusLow risk

Present in Samoa; pregnant women should take precautions against mosquito bites.

Food and waterborne diseasesModerate risk

Common due to bacterial contamination; drink bottled or boiled water and eat well-cooked food.

Based on CDC and WHO guidance. Consult a travel medicine clinic 4–6 weeks before departure for personalised advice.
